    Had the same problem, finally realized that the FileVault Encryption was struck at 19%. Speed back up to normal after I disabled FileVault using terminal command - sudo fdesetup diable
    To check whether the FileVault is the culprit, go to System Preferences --> Security & Privacy --> FileVault to see if encryption is in progress.. For me the blue bar was less than a quarter with status 'estimating time remaining'..
    Then open Terminal and type in: sudo fdesetup disable
    It will then ask for the admin password (to be it asked twice), then it was disabled... Back to normal life again..

  • Can you remove Old Backup files from Time Machine sooner?

    So I'm aware that the default settings state that Time Machine will start to delete old backup files from your saved destination once that destination starts to approach full storage capacity. But what if you are not looking to fill up most of your storage capacity with Time Machine backups? Is there a way where you can cut the delete threshold in half and have Time Machine delete old backup files sooner rather than later?

  • Are old backup files saved or deleted in iTunes

    I had to restore my Iphone back to factory. The backup file I created was too big to restore and the Verizon tech (who I foolishly let take over my computer) backed up the empty phone over the old backup file. I found a program to restore the original backup data, but it's been overwritten by the recent backup. Does iTunes delete the the old backup files or store them in a different folder?

    iTunes only keeps one normal backup, per iOS device. As you've found out, its an incremental backup in that data that has changed or deleted is added or removed from the backup. Unless you backup your computer, your data is gone.
